ABSTRACT
In this paper, we propose a simple and fully distributed mechanism for constructing and maintaining the overlay topology in mesh-based P2P-TV systems. Our algorithm optimizes the topology to better exploit large bandwidth peers, so that they are automatically moved close to the source. This improves the chunk delivery delay so that all peers benefit, not just the high bandwidth ones. A key property of the proposed scheme is its ability to indirectly estimate the upload bandwidth of peers without explicitly knowing or measuring it. Simulation results show that our scheme significantly outperforms overlays with homogeneous properties, achieving up to 50% performance improvement. Moreover, the algorithm is robust to both parameter setting and changing conditions, e.g., peer churning.
- L. Massoulie, A. Twigg, C. Gkantsidis, and P. Rodriguez. "Randomized decentralized broadcasting algorithms", IEEE Infocom, Anchorage, AK, May 2007.Google ScholarDigital Library
- T. Bonald, L. Massoulie, F. Mathieu, D. Perino, A, Twigg, "Epidemic Live Streaming: Optimal Performance Trade-Offs", ACM Sigmetrics, Annapolis, ML, June 2008. Google ScholarDigital Library
- A. P. C.da Silva, E. Leonardi, M. Mellia, M. Meo, "A Bandwidth-Aware Scheduling Strategy for P2P-TV Systems, IEEE P2P", Aachen, DE,September 2008. Google ScholarDigital Library
- Yong Liu, "On the minimum delay peer-to-peer video streaming: how realtime can it be?", ACM Multimedia, Augsburg, DE, September 2007. Google ScholarDigital Library
- F. Picconi and L. Massoulie, "Is there a future for mesh-based live video streaming?", IEEE P2P 2008, Aachen, DE, September 2008. Google ScholarDigital Library
- R. Rejaie, A. Ortega, "PALS: peer-to-peer adaptive layered streaming," ACM NOSSDAV 03, Monterey, CA, USA, June 2003. Google ScholarDigital Library
- R. Iqbal, B. Hariri, S. Shirmohammadi "Modeling and Evaluation of Overlay Generation Problem for Peer-assisted Video Adaptation and Streaming," ACM NOSSDAV 08, Braunschweig, Germany, May 2008. Google ScholarDigital Library
- T. Small, B. Liang, B. Li, "Scaling laws and tradeoffs in peer-to-peer live multimedia streaming," ACM Multimedia 06, Santa Barbara, CA, USA, Oct. 2006. Google ScholarDigital Library
- Network-Aware P2P-TV Application over Wise Networks, http://www.napa-wine.euGoogle Scholar
- Bela Bollobas. "Random Graphs," Cambridge University Press, 2001.Google Scholar
- Dongni Ren, Y.T. Hillman Li, S.H. Gary Chan, "On Reducing Mesh Delay for Peer-to-Peer Live Streaming," IEEE Infocom, Phoenix, AZ, April 2008.Google Scholar
- R.J.Lobb, A. P. C.da Silva, E. Leonardi, M. Mellia, M. Meo. Adaptive Overlays: a Feasibility Study, Tech. Rep. - Polito092802-1. Available from http://www.tlc.polito.it/mellia/Polito092802-1.pdfGoogle Scholar
Index Terms
- Adaptive overlay topology for mesh-based P2P-TV systems
Recommendations
An adaptive P2P overlay for MANETs
ICDCN '15: Proceedings of the 16th International Conference on Distributed Computing and NetworkingIn recent years, many researchers have focused on the deployment of Peer-To-Peer (or P2P) applications over Mobile-Adhoc NETworks (or MANETs) motivated by the common characteristics shared between the P2P overlay and the MANET underlay such as ...
Experimental comparison of a tree-based and a mesh-based peer-to-peer video streaming system
Grid and P2P SystemsWe analyse two commercial peer-to-peer (P2P) video streaming systems via active measurements: a tree-based overlay multicast and a mesh-based overlay. Our controlled IP test bed allows us to reproduce near-identical network conditions for both systems ...
An adaptive buffer-map exchange mechanism for pull-based peer-to-peer video-on-demand streaming systems
Unlike P2P live video streaming in which all the peers in a channel watch a video with tiny differences in viewing points, in P2P video on demand (VoD) streaming systems, neighbor peers may watch the same video with more different viewing points; ...
Comments